The Journal of Clinical and Translational Immunology (JCTI) provides a streamlined submission system designed to make the publication process efficient, transparent, and author-friendly. All manuscripts must be submitted online and will be processed according to the following steps.
1. Preparing Your Manuscript
Before submission, authors should:
- Carefully review the Instructions for Authors to ensure proper formatting and style.
- Prepare all required sections, including title page, abstract, figures, tables, references, and supplementary files (if applicable).
- Ensure compliance with ethical standards, including approval from ethics committees, informed consent, and adherence to animal welfare regulations.
- Verify originality by checking for plagiarism and confirming that the work has not been published or submitted elsewhere.
2. Online Submission
- Manuscripts must be submitted through the journal’s online submission page.
- Authors should create an account, upload their manuscript files, and complete the submission checklist.
- A cover letter must accompany the submission, summarize the significance of the work and confirm that all authors have approved the manuscript.
3. Initial Editorial Screening
- The editorial office conducts a preliminary check for scope, formatting, originality, and ethical compliance.
- Manuscripts that do not meet basic requirements may be returned to authors for correction or declined at this stage.
4. Peer Review Assignment
- Suitable manuscripts are assigned to a Handling Editor.
- The manuscript is then sent to at least two independent expert reviewers under a double-blind peer review process.
5. Peer Review and Decision
- Reviewers provide detailed feedback on the manuscript’s scientific quality, originality, and clarity.
- Based on reviewer recommendations, the editor makes one of the following decisions:
- Accept without changes
- Minor revision
- Major revision (revise and resubmit)
- Reject
6. Revision Process
- Authors invited to revise their manuscript must submit a point-by-point response letter addressing each reviewer’s comment.
- Revised manuscripts are reassessed by editors and, if necessary, returned to reviewers for further evaluation.
7. Final Acceptance
- Once the manuscript satisfies all editorial and reviewer requirements, it is formally accepted for publication.
- Authors receive an official acceptance letter along with details about the production process.
8. Production and Publication
- Accepted manuscripts undergo copyediting, typesetting, and proofreading to ensure accuracy and consistency.
- The final article is published online under an open access license (CC BY), making it freely available to the global scientific community.
9. Post-Publication
- Articles are indexed, archived, and promoted to maximize visibility and citation impact.
- Authors may share their work widely in accordance with the open-access policy.
